At a ceremony in Canberra on Tuesday night the wholly owned subsidiary of the University of Wollongong, was announced as the 2018 winner of the Australian Export Awards for excellence in education and training.
UOW Global Enterprises is now a leading international provider of offshore education institutions with UOW in Dubai, the UOW College in Hong Kong, KDU in Malaysia as well as a UOW College in Australia.
About 10,000 students from 95 countries currently undertake studies in one or more of its 50 undergraduate and post-graduate qualifications, and 20 diploma and vocational qualifications.
